AAEON BOXER-6647-MTH is an embedded Box PC powered by Intel Core Ultra 7 155H or Core Ultra 5 125H Meteor Lake processor, and mainly designed for advanced industrial robotics solutions such as AGV (Automated Guided Vehicle) and AMR (Autonomous Mobile Robot). The rugged computer supports up to 64GB DDR5 RAM, is equipped with screwless external SATA and M.2 M-Key trays, offers 2.5GbE networking, four USB 3.2 interfaces, RS-232/422/485 & DIO for cameras, sensors (LIDAR, IMUs, etc…), and actuators for robotics, as well as wireless and cellular expansion via additional M.2 sockets. Boardcon SBC3576 – A feature-rich Rockchip RK3576 SBC with HDMI, mini DP, dual GbE, WiFi 6, optional 5G/4G LTE module, and more
Boardcon SBC3576 is a feature-rich single board computer (SBC) based on the MINI3576 system-on-module powered by a Rockchip RK3576 AI SoC and equipped with two 100-pin and one 44-pin board-to-board connectors for interfacing with the carrier board. The carrier board is equipped with up to 8GB RAM, 128GB eMMC flash, two gigabit Ethernet ports, a WiFi 6 and Bluetooth 5.3 module, 4K-capable HDMI 2.1 and mini DP video outputs, a mini HDMI input port, a USB 3.0 Type-A port, RS485 and CAN Bus terminal block, and more. The Rockchip RK3576 SoC comes with the same 6 TOPS NPU found in the Rockchip RK3588/RK3588S SoC and can be used as a lower-cost alternative with less performance. Radxa ROCK 5T SBC packs ROCK 5 ITX mini-ITX motherboard’s features onto a 110x80mm PCB
Radxa ROCK 5T is yet another Rockchip RK3588 SBC whose main selling point is to pack most features of the ROCK 5 ITX mini-ITX motherboard (170x170mm) into a much smaller 110x80mm board. The board features up to 32GB RAM, M.2 2280 sockets for NVMe SSDs, four independent display outputs via HDMI, USB-C, and MIPI DSI, HDMI input and camera interfaces, two 2.5GbE RJ45 jacks, on-board WiFi 6/6E and Bluetooth 5.x, and an M.2 Key-B socket for cellular connectivity. AAEON GENE-MTH6 3.5-inch Meteor Lake SBC offers up to 96GB of DDR5, 9-36V wide power input, PCIe Gen4 FPC connector
AAEON GENE-MTH6 Intel Meteor Lake-powered 3.5-inch “Subcompact” SBC takes up to 96GB DDR5, offers an ERP-compliant 9V-36V wide power input range, and includes an unusual PCIe Gen4 x4 FPC connector to add an M.2 expansion module, or other custom modules. The board also features two 2.5GbE and one GbE port, supports WiFi 6 and 5G via M.2 sockets, a SATA port and an M.2 socket for storage expansion, four display interfaces, a few USB ports, four internal COM ports for RS232 and/or RS485, and more. It is offered with either 15W U-Series (Intel Core Ultra 5 125U / Core Ultra 7 155U) or 28W H-series (Intel Core Ultra 5 125H / Core Ultra 7 155H) processors. Altair ALT1350 based HL7900 5G LPWA module supports Wi-SUN, GNSS, and NB-IoT over non-terrestrial networks
The HL7900 5G LPWA module from Semtech (Sierra Wireless) is a globally certified solution built around Sony’s Altair ALT1350 chip and designed for low-power IoT applications. It is certified by major U.S. carriers, including AT&T, T-Mobile, and Verizon, as well as Japan’s KDDI, and has achieved global regulatory certifications (FCC, CE, ISED, etc.) and industry certifications (PTCRB, GCF) for carrier interoperability. This chip features an ultra-low-power sensor hub MCU for efficient environmental monitoring. Additionally, it includes integrated sub-GHz and 2.4GHz radios supporting short-range protocols such as Wi-SUN including U-Bus Air, NB-IoT, and 5G NTN along with GNSS and Wi-Fi-based indoor/outdoor tracking. Furthermore, this chip supports embedded SIM support, secure edge-to-cloud connectivity, and over-the-air updates. These features make this chip useful for applications such as asset tracking, urban navigation, and other IoT solutions requiring reliable, low-power connectivity with global reach. Queclink WR310 – A compact 5G and WiFi 6 industrial cellular router with four GbE ports, GNSS, and RS232 and RS485 interfaces
Queclink WR310 5G and WiFi 6 industrial cellular router features four gigabit Ethernet ports, a USB Type-A port, a terminal block with RS232 and RS485, and a wide 8 to 32V DC input suitable for smart manufacturing, industrial IoT (IIoT), and edge computing applications. It looks to be a more compact and cost-optimized version of the Queclink WR300 5G industrial router introduced in 2023 with global 5G coverage. AAEON BOXER-8654AI-KIT – NVIDIA Jetson Orin NX-based Edge AI kit features four gigabit Ethernet ports with PoE support
The AAEON BOXER-8654AI-KIT Edge AI kit is a compact development kit built around the NVIDIA Jetson Orin NX modules with four gigabit Ethernet ports (with optional PoE) and an Out-of-Band (OOB) management header, and designed for applications like smart cities, IoT ecosystems, edge AI, and others. The multi-functional carrier board also offers six USB 3.2 Gen 2 ports, HDMI video output, two MIPI CSI, two DB-9 ports for RS-232/422/485 and CAN Bus, and a 40-pin NVIDIA Jetson-compatible GPIO header for I2C, SPI, and UART interfaces. Expansion options include M.2 E and B-key slots for Wi-Fi and 5G modules (with onboard SIM), an M.2 M-Key slot for NVMe SSDs, and a SATA connector. Siflower SF21H8898 is a quad-core 64-bit RISC-V SoC for industrial gateways, routers, and controllers
Siflower SF21H8898 SoC features a quad-core 64-bit RISC-V processor clocked at up to 1.25 GHz and a network processing unit (NPU) for handling traffic and is designed for industrial-grade gateways, controllers, and routers. The chip supports up to 2GB DDR3, DDR3L, or DDR4 memory, offers QSGMII (quad GbE), SGMII/HSGMII (GbE/2.5GbE), and RGMII (GbE) networking interfaces, and USB 2.0, PCIE 2.0, SPI, UART, I2C, and PWM interfaces.
